The regulators are almost always based on a belleville washer stack. They usually stop working when they get a bit of corrosion on them that prevents them from sliding along each other in the stack. Many times a bit of 100% synthetic oil oil introduced where the tank mounts to the rifle will shake i...

Respectfully, another possibiity is a dirty chamber. 6007s have tight chambers to begin with and a bit of build-up results in the round not fully seating. The firing pin will strike the round and instead of going off, it is pushed further into the chamber, the rim will have the appearance of a light...
